This software … Web10 de mai. de 2024 · Hide files and folders on Windows 10 desktop. Step 1: On your Windows 10 desktop, perform a right-click on the file or folder icon that you would like to hide and then click the Properties option. Step 2: In the resulting dialog box, switch to the General tab. Step 3: Here, check the Hidden checkbox and then click the Apply button.

Web3 de jul. de 2024 · In Windows, file attributes are used instead. These can be modified with attrib.exe or via Explorer, when its configured to show hidden items. – vonPryz Jun 12, 2024 at 12:47 1 You can alter the attributes without resorting to any other utility in powershell: (Get-ChildItem SomeFile.txt).Attributes = 'Hidden' – EBGreen Jun 12, 2024 … Web11 de abr. de 2024 · You can show hidden files and folders to make your files to be displayed again. It is easy to do this: Step 1: Press Windows + E to open File Explorer. Step 2: Click View from the top menu, then check Hidden items. This will make Windows show all hidden files and folders.
